What are some common challenges faced by professionals in wireless algorithm roles,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in wireless algorithm roles often encounter challenges such as optimizing algorithms for real-time performance, adapting to rapidly evolving wireless standards, and ensuring robust performance under varying network conditions. Addressing these challenges typically involves close collaboration with hardware and software teams to balance computational complexity and accuracy, as well as staying updated with the latest research and industry trends. Seeking mentorship from experienced colleagues and participating in cross-functional meetings can also provide valuable insights and foster innovative solutions.

What is the difference between Wireless Algorithm vs Wireless Network Engineer?

AspectWireless AlgorithmWireless Network Engineer
Primary FocusDesigning and developing algorithms for wireless communication systemsPlanning, implementing, and maintaining wireless networks
Required SkillsMathematics, signal processing, algorithm developmentNetwork configuration, troubleshooting, hardware/software integration
Work EnvironmentResearch labs, R&D departments, software development teamsTelecom companies, IT departments, network service providers
CertificationsTypically none specific, advanced degrees preferredCCNA, CWNA, CompTIA Network+

Wireless Algorithm specialists focus on creating algorithms to improve wireless communication performance, while Wireless Network Engineers implement and manage wireless networks in real-world environments. Both roles require technical expertise but differ in their core responsibilities and work settings.

What does a Wireless Algorithm Engineer do?

A Wireless Algorithm Engineer designs, develops, and optimizes algorithms that enable wireless communication systems, such as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, 5G, and more. Their work focuses on improving signal processing, data transmission, interference management, and network efficiency. They often collaborate with hardware and software teams to implement these algorithms in real-world products. This role requires a strong background in mathematics, signal processing, and wireless communication stand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Wireless Algorithm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Wireless Algorithm Engineer, you need a solid background in wireless communications, signal processing, and strong programming skills, typically supported by an advanced degree in electrical engineering or a related field. Familiarity with simulation tools like MATLAB, Python, C/C++, and wireless protocol standards is crucial, as are relevant certifications or experience with 5G/6G systems.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ective collaboration are standout soft skills for this position. These skills and qualities are essential for designing robust wireless solutions that drive innovation and ensure reliable connectivity in complex technical environments.

Job description

Lockheed Martin Missiles and Fire Control (MFC) is seeking a Senior RF Engineer to join our growing engineering team. MFC is a recognized designer, developer, and manufacturer of precision engagement aerospace and defense systems for the U.S. and allied militaries.
This role offers an excellent working environment with a mix of cutting-edge design, hands-on laboratory testing, and product development. You will work with and learn from industry-leading RF and microwave design professionals in a collaborative, mission-driven environment.
What You Will Be Doing
The Senior RF Engineer will serve as a key technical contributor on one or more defense programs, supporting the design, development, analysis, and test of advanced RF systems and subsystems. Responsibilities may include:
Leading and contributing to the design, development, and implementation of RF and RADAR systems, including signal processing algorithm development and high-fidelity simulation environments
Conducting RF simulation analysis, antenna test data analysis, and captive flight test performance data analysis to evaluate sensor and system performance
Developing and optimizing signal processing algorithms for RF applications such as RADAR, wireless communications, and software defined radios (SDR)
Using MATLAB, Python, and C++ for tool development, scripting, simulation, data analysis, and code review
Performing RF requirements analyses, executing trade studies, and providing data-driven recommendations during design reviews
Collaborating with cross-functional and multi-company teams, interfacing with suppliers, partners, and customers to balance competing priorities
Developing and maintaining technical documentation, analysis packages, validation reports, and lessons-learned documentation
Managing version-controlled repositories (e.g., GitLab), creating merge requests, and documenting changes
Preparing status briefs for program leadership and partner contractors, highlighting analysis findings and risk items
This position offers the opportunity to work alongside experienced RF and microwave design professionals and gain exposure to cutting-edge defense technology. Strong career growth and advancement opportunities are available.
